Threeweavers Brewing Expatriate
LOC: Inglewood, California ABV: 6.9% | IBUS: N/A | SRM: N/A
What the brewer says
“Inspired by the Three Weavers Community, our West Coast IPA is bright and laden with notes of tropical fruits. Brewed with 2-row barley and a touch of English crystal malt and loaded with New Age American hops, Expatriate is home no matter where you are.”
What our panel thought
Aroma: “Clean. Fresh. Lemony and piney hops aroma. A little bit of malty sweetness.” Flavor: “Prominent hops presence. Kale, grapefruit, orange peel, dank, and pine flavors. Pleasantly malty as it warms up. A very enjoyable West Coast IPA with something extra to make it stand out. Bright and crisp with just enough body to support the hops.” Overall: “It’s clean and direct with a balance that tilts a bit more toward citrus and dank than straight bitterness. A well-executed West Coast IPA that feels modern and current by highlighting contemporary hops techniques.”
AROMA: 11 APPEARANCE: 3 FLAVOR: 20 MOUTHFEEL: 4 OVERALL: 10 96
